Cox Communications has announced the addition of 14 channels to subscribers in South Hampton Roads. This brings Cox's total HD offerings to 46 channels, and brings Cox's total HD choices to over 250 to its customers in the area.

New High-Definition Channels for Cox Video Customers in Virginia
Cox Video subscribers will have access to 13 additional HD channels as well as "Chiller," a new horror film network with titles such as "Alfred Hitchcock Presents" and "Tales from the Crypt." The additional HD channels include: Lifetime Network HD; Hallmark Movie Channel HD; USA HD; Lifetime Movie Network HD; MTV HD; CNBC HD; Nickelodeon HD; CMT HD; Sci-Fi HD; Spike HD; Bravo HD; VH1 HD; and Planet Green HD.
